Peppy Mehendi

A vivacious mehndi ceremony drenched in colours, fun and good vibes was what officially kickstarted the wedding revelries of Aanchal and Ishan. The diva bride Aanchal envisioned a colourful ceremony but picked only 2 shades–pink and yellow for the primary decorations. Instead of the usual genda phools decorations, the venue chirped with bright colourful ribbons, paper props and a DIY setup. Some more fun props like #TeamBride Straws and a favour cart replete with clutches, bangles and earrings kept the guests busy. And the simplistic yet quirky mehndi seating area was everybody's favourite spot. Every photo clicked during the mehndi ceremony turned out beautifully bright!

Talking about the couple, well Aanchal skipped a formal lehenga and giggled around in a vivid yellow kurta and jacket set. Spilling the beans about the same, the bride shares, "I knew this was my only chill event and the kurta-jacket kept me cosy and warm. Still managed to my twirls though." Completing her mehndi look were the uber gorgeous gota jewels comprising of a maang tikka, a statement ring and a pair of earrings. The groom Ishan kept it all comfortable to be able to dance his heart out on Dhol; he wore a kurta set and amped it up with a Nehru jacket.

Engagement + Sangeet

The Sangeet cum Engagement ceremony was a night of all things WOW! A dramatic arch-filled pathway led to the main event which was bedecked with fairy lights. Even the pool was surreally beautified with floating candles (major decor goals)! Also, ditching the quintessential colourful LED lights helped the couple get the most amazing stage photos ever. FYI, the colourful light used on stage for decorations kill the real colours in photographs.

Aanchal bedazzled in a midnight blue gota patti lehenga which she unexpectedly found at a store in Delhi's Rajouri Garden market! She added new gota and pearl borders to the dupatta (sourced from Lajpat Nagar) to make it 'bridal enough' and completed the look with kundan set and a stack of bangles. Ishan matched the look in a bandhgala set and white bottoms. A peppy 90's playlist played the entire night giving the feels of an elaborate Sangeet night straight out from a Karan Johar movie.

Unmissable tips from the bride

- I got my mehendi done a day before the main event, which gave me time to get my mehendi photoshoot in peace and also dance without a worry on the main event day.

- I escaped the crazy haldi that's currently trending online but still managed some happy, skin-friendly moments. 

- Working closely with wedding photographers taught me the importance of lighting at night events. The ring ceremony + sangeet was our only night event and my brief to Clique Events was simple; no coloured LEDs, let my fairy lights shine. And shine they did, giving us the best stage pictures ever!

- I'm a fan of day pheras - both as a planner and as the bride. Everyone's chirpy and cheerful, no oldies sleeping in the background and finally, the nice and bright pictures as memories for life! 

- I knew Mehndi was my only chill event, so I skipped a formal lehenga and bought a comfy kurta + jacket combo to keep me warm and cosy. Still managed to do my twirls though!
